80 lines
2.0 KiB
TeX
80 lines
2.0 KiB
TeX
|
\skbheading{La fiche du personnel administratif dans l’annuaire du module Scribe}
|
|||
|
Le personnel administratif, dans l’annuaire du module Scribe, est la conjonction de plusieurs classes d’objets :
|
|||
|
\begin{itemize}
|
|||
|
\item top
|
|||
|
\item person
|
|||
|
\item organizationalPerson
|
|||
|
\item posixAccount
|
|||
|
\item shadowAccount
|
|||
|
\item inetOrgPerson
|
|||
|
\item sambaSamAccount
|
|||
|
\item administratif
|
|||
|
\item ENTPerson
|
|||
|
\item ENTAuxNonEnsEtab
|
|||
|
\item radiusprofile
|
|||
|
\end{itemize}
|
|||
|
|
|||
|
La partie métier est portée par les classes \emph{administratif}, \emph{ENTPerson} et \emph{ENTAuxNonEnsEtab}.
|
|||
|
Les attributs susceptibles d’être associés à un personnel administratif sont les suivants :
|
|||
|
\begin{itemize}
|
|||
|
\item les attributs issus de la classe administratif :
|
|||
|
\begin{itemize}
|
|||
|
\item dont les attributs obligatoires :
|
|||
|
\begin{itemize}
|
|||
|
\item typeadmin
|
|||
|
\item codecivilite
|
|||
|
\end{itemize}
|
|||
|
\item et les attributs optionnels :
|
|||
|
\begin{itemize}
|
|||
|
\item dateNaissance
|
|||
|
\item mailDir
|
|||
|
\item mailHost
|
|||
|
\item intid
|
|||
|
\item FederationKey
|
|||
|
\item Divcod
|
|||
|
\item ManagedGroup
|
|||
|
\item LastUpdate
|
|||
|
\item mailAlternateAddress
|
|||
|
\end{itemize}
|
|||
|
\end{itemize}
|
|||
|
|
|||
|
\item les attributs issus de la classe ENTPerson :
|
|||
|
\begin{itemize}
|
|||
|
\item dont les attributs obligatoires :
|
|||
|
\begin{itemize}
|
|||
|
\item ENTPersonLogin
|
|||
|
\item ENTPersonJointure
|
|||
|
\end{itemize}
|
|||
|
\item et les attributs optionnels :
|
|||
|
\begin{itemize}
|
|||
|
\item ENTPersonAutresPrenoms
|
|||
|
\item ENTPersonNomPatro
|
|||
|
\item ENTPersonSexe
|
|||
|
\item ENTPersonCentresInteret
|
|||
|
\item ENTPersonAdresse
|
|||
|
\item ENTPersonCodePostal
|
|||
|
\item ENTPersonVille
|
|||
|
\item ENTPersonPays
|
|||
|
\item ENTPersonAlias
|
|||
|
\item ENTPersonStructRattach
|
|||
|
\item ENTPersonFonctions
|
|||
|
\item ENTPersonProfils
|
|||
|
\item ENTPersonDateNaissance
|
|||
|
\item personalTitle
|
|||
|
\end{itemize}
|
|||
|
\end{itemize}
|
|||
|
|
|||
|
\item les attributs issus de la classe ENTAuxNonEnsEtab :
|
|||
|
\begin{itemize}
|
|||
|
\item dont les attributs obligatoires :
|
|||
|
\begin{itemize}
|
|||
|
\item aucun attribut obligatoire
|
|||
|
\end{itemize}
|
|||
|
\item et les attributs optionnels :
|
|||
|
\begin{itemize}
|
|||
|
\item ENTAuxNonEnsEtabService
|
|||
|
\end{itemize}
|
|||
|
\end{itemize}
|
|||
|
\end{itemize}
|
|||
|
|